J (also known as Pokémon Hunter J), is a ruthless and cruel Pokémon hunter around Sinnoh who caught and stole Pokémon and sold them in the black market for money.

Biography

J appeared in Pokémon Diamond and Pearl, with her army of henchmen whose primary means of transportation were advanced 6-wheeled armored trucks. The trucks were used to take all the Pokémon they captured to J's airship, so that they could be sold on the black market. Her airship's capabilities included lasers, a cloaking device, a high-tech visor to follow Pokémon that got away using teleport. The ship had a gun that steamed gold cement, which was used to turn Pokémon into statutes, as well as strong glass cases to contain Pokémon.

Hunter J has shown interest in Ash's Pikachu, as well as Team Rocket's Meowth. She managed to turn both Pikachu and Meowth into stone, but Ash, his friends, and Team Rocket members, Jessie and James, managed to save all the Pokémon that I had turned to stone.

I attempted to capture the legendary Pokémon, Regigigas by forcing it to wake up with her Salamence's Flamethrower while the Pokémon was at Snowpoint Temple. Despite this, she was unable to capture Regigigas due to the efforts of Pyramid King Brandon and his Pokémon. J immediately withdrew from the area when her client decided to cancel the deal regarding Regigigas

Unlike other villains who have appeared in the series, J is one of the few who have not been defeated or been arrested by police.

Ash and Gary were determined to rescue a group of Shieldon captured by J, Gary said to Ash Ketchum that since they had recovered the Shieldon it was enough. Later on Ash teamed with a "High Ranked" Pokémon Ranger (in which he's called a Top Ranger) who's protecting a Riolu from J in order to bring it to her client and not even they could defeat her.

Hunter J does not care about the wellbeing of people, Pokémon, or even her own henchmen.

J and her goons went down with their ship after it was hit by Uxie and Mesprit's Future Sight attack while attempting to capture the Pokémon for Team Galactic. Team Rocket claimed to their boss, Giovanni, that they were responsible for J and Team Galactic's defeat, causing their promotion. It is unknown if she or her Pokémon survived the explosion.
